Personally I have no objections to proceed with updating to OpenLDAP 2.5.
But there are significant config changes (e.g. regarding ppolicy schema). Existing slapd configurations might not even start correctly.

This submission is broken. The .la files in /usr/lib/openldap must be kept, because slapd.conf has e.g. a line like moduleload back_mdb.la
